In DEF sin D= 24/26 what is cos E

Answer:
B) 24/26
Step-by-step explanation:
The ratio of sine is opposite/hypotenuse. This means the side opposite angle D, EF, has length 24 and the hypotenuse, DE, has length 26.
The ratio of cosine is adjacent/hypotenuse. For cos E, we want the side adjacent to E (EF) and the hypotenuse (DE). Using these, we have the ratio 24/26.
